matlab画图从0开始画
来源:学生作业帮助网 编辑:作业帮 时间:2024/11/20 03:10:59
你先学下matlab基本知识吧
x=(0.1:0.1:80);y=zeros(1,800); fori=1:1:800 ifi<=100  
程序可以更改如下:但是执行结果表明找不到解析的结果,说明你的积分函数太复杂.以下满足语法规则但是找不到满意的结果.%globaln1n2arku1u2e1e2%这句可要可不要n1=10^(-3);n2
A=[1 3 4 5 6 7 6 7 8];plot(A)hold on%表示继续在图上画图而不擦去原来的图x
楼主不是想保留0:3这个信息?如果是的话,可以用结构数据来保存,或者是令k=0:3,然后显示的时候为t(k+1)不就行了.又或者编个函数,转换一下
你好,方程里面没有c参数,我参照你的方程做出了如下的图象横纵坐标分别为xy z坐标为c(x,y)clc,clearclose allx = 1; y&
输入a的数据;x=a(:,1);y=a(:,2);plot(x,y);
其实这是图论中无向图的一个距离矩阵啊,很容易,比如四行对应的定点分别为a,b,c,d,则a与b之间有边,其权重为2,a与c之间有边,其权重为3,b与c之间有边,其权重为1,整个无向图总共就只有这么3条
为避免被零除,加eps这样就可以了x=-1:0.03:1;y=-1:0.03:1;[X,Y]=meshgrid(x,y);Z=1.0./sqrt((0.2+X).^2+Y.^2+eps)+1.0./s
直接画不就成了么;stem(d,l);就可以得出图像了啊.
如果是画2维曲线图,就用plot如果是画3维曲线图,就用plot3,如果是画一图像,就用imagesc,具体参数用法,可以使用help文档
首先定义变量或者用excel的.xls电子表格向matlab导入变量x,Y,T,t的数据之后使用plot(H,自变量)绘制图像.再问:你能子啊说说怎嚒中xls中导入数据吗。举个例子吧
需要过的点:x=横坐标;y=纵坐标;w=你要延长之后的倍数,大于1;xx=0:0.5:x;yy=xx*y/x;xx=w*xx;yy=w*yy;plot(xx,yy);
化为最简因式,恒大于零的部分把它去掉,如果x前面的系数有奇数个小于零,则从右下开始.其实你可以把左边x的系数都化为大于零,全部都从右向左从上到下画线.如果原来左边的系数是小于零的,相应不等式变号就行了
从0开始,a:b,从a开始每个加1,直至不大于
像这样?a=rand(4,4,400);plot(1:400,squeeze(a(1,1,:)))
例如让x=012345则x=0:5
x=linspace(eps,1,100);>>y=1./x;>>plot(x,y)>>axis([010100])%如果不加这句,图像很难看..>>%matlab里面是没有取开集的说法的,接近于0,
x=linspace(0,pi,100);%这里可以控制范围和取样间隔,这是从0到pi,100点y=sin(x.*x);inty=cumtrapz(y);plot(x,inty);再问:лл�㣬���
a=0:1/36*pi:2*pi改成a=0:1/18*pi:2*pi